Local Sai Baba devotees close businesses during mourning

Earlier this week, at least 25 stores on Regent Street, Georgetown were closed following the performance of the final rites of Indian spiritual guru Sri Sathya Sai Baba.

The owners of these stores, followers of the late Baba, closed their establishments for 24 hours as a sign of mourning on Wednesday. Business resumed as per normal yesterday, but devotees of the late guru are still struggling
